Effects of temperature, vapour pressure deficit and radiation on infectivity of conidia of Botrytis cinerea and on susceptibility of gerbera petals.
Author(s) : KERSSIES A.
Type of article: Article
Summary
Inspite of the higher temperature, the number of lesions in spring and summer were lower than in other seasons, in spite of the presence of high numbers of B. cinerea spores. The effect of temperature on the susceptibility of Gerbera flowers was explained by changes in water status in the petals.
